>>> We gave the chair binding authority to negotiate and execute a
>>> contract.  Negotiation, naturally, is just that.  You don't get everything
>>> you want because both sides of a negotiation want to get things.  Asking
>>> someone to negotiate for you is asking them to navigate those trade-offs
>>> for you, to make these decisions.  I don't think we should have done that.
>>> When we were waiting for a contract, I would have supported a rescission -
>>> not because I thought the chair was doing a bad job or I was worried about
>>> the terms, but because the long wait suggested to me that there was a
>>> stalemate, and sometimes you can break a stalemate by putting in a new
>>> person.
>>>
>>> That isn't what we're talking about here, though.  Instead, after giving
>>> this task to the chair, this is an effort to turn around when the task is
>>> done and criticize the priorities chosen and decisions made and say "you
>>> could have gotten a better deal without giving anything up."  How do we
>>> know that?  We don't, but we'd be banking on it, because if not, we're not
>>> going to get a new deal anytime soon.
>>>
>>> I find it very aggravating that we pushed this task onto the chair, and
>>> now want to say "you should have done it differently."  I also see no plan
>>> for what will come next here.  Do we select a new negotiator?  What if the
>>> LNC doesn't like what they come back with, either?  Surely no one expects
>>> this entire body to negotiate a contract, which is not too many cook
>>> spoiling the broth - it's 20 cooks trying to flip a pancake.
>>>
>>> I vote no.
